Transaction 31bf1ae710cdae0118aa636df9365f9807bf694d137a40bb1994cf12880d9ef5

1 Input
2 Outputs
  • 31bf1ae710cdae0118aa636df9365f9807bf694d137a40bb1994cf12880d9ef5:0
  • value  9565051
    address  395kCViKHJLBJwhfrbNxpFkP5Ucud87z9Q
  • 31bf1ae710cdae0118aa636df9365f9807bf694d137a40bb1994cf12880d9ef5:1
  • value  10929920
    address  3GeQCjbfgH6QTrnZ17FDJeMsYTSsCnrdd2